Here's why some age-old traditions totally make sense
The soothing sound of the bell creates a harmony between the left and right lobes of the brain.

India is a pristine land of traditions and rituals. We all refer to our customs and traditions as diverse and unique. However, despite being born into this rich culture we lack the understanding behind many traditional practices and often label them superstitious. Here are a few facts that prove how thoughtful our ancestors were in designing various rituals and customs for our holistic well-being.

#1
Significance of the 'namaste' gesture

Namaste, a gesture expressing humility and gratitude, is used to acknowledge and greet people. When we join the palms of our hands in a namaste it is called Anjali Mudra. Practicing the Anjali Mudra regularly enhances concentration, calms the mind, and helps relieve stress. The Anjali Mudra channelizes our thought process temporarily and balances the working of the adrenal and pituitary glands.

#3
Significance of meditation

The objective of meditation is to attain oneness between the practitioner's spirit (Jeevatma) and the almighty (Paramatma). Meditation is meant to calm your body, mind, and senses. A short meditation session can boost your productivity and concentration levels. Apart from taking care of your emotional health, it also looks after your physical well-being by reducing headaches, insomnia, joint and muscle problems.

#4
Cooking with turmeric

Turmeric is the most versatile spice used in India for generations. It has had many uses--from playing an important role in certain religious ceremonies to textile dying and enhancing the taste of food. Turmeric also has several medicinal qualities as it supports the immune system, is anti-inflammatory, increases the antioxidant capacity of the body, and lowers the risk of heart diseases.

#6
Drinking water from copper vessels

Copper is an essential mineral for human health. It can kill microorganisms like molds, fungi, and bacteria, present in the water that could cause harm to the body. Water from a copper vessel also helps maintain the body's pH (acid-alkaline) balance. Copper is known to prevent anemia, reduce cholesterol and triglyceride levels. Trace amounts of copper are critical for the regulation of blood pressure.
